Minifier should detect if a file is already minified and just include it without minifying it a second time.
Processing an already minified js file sometimes leads to a:
ErrorException in Minifier.php line 476: Unclosed string at position
This is not really an issue with the minify module itself, but with JSshrink and how it's beeing used. The error is thrown in vendor/tedivm/jshrink/src/JShrink/Minifier.php around line 471:
// New lines in strings without line delimiters are bad- actual
// new lines will be represented by the string \n and not the actual
// character, so those will be treated just fine using the switch
// block below.
case "\n":
throw new \RuntimeException('Unclosed string at position: ' . $startpos );
break;

...break the minified version when prepended to another file.
I've had this issue with qtip.min.js:
/* qTip2 v2.2.1 | Plugins: tips viewport imagemap svg modal ie6 | Styles: core basic css3 | qtip2.com | Licensed MIT | Sat Sep 06 2014 18:25:06 */
!function(a,b,c){/* Their code here... */}(window,document);
//# sourceMappingURL=//cdn.jsdelivr.net/qtip2/2.2.1//var/www/qtip2/build/tmp/tmp-656464emu9s/jquery.qtip.min.map
They're missing a trailing line break (which is ok), but when you combine it to other files and minify, the output is broken – the first line of code from the next file is missing. I think we should simply "sanitize" input files by adding a trailing line break if missing. Any objection?
